What Shades Complement Blue for Every Season

The versatility of blue makes it a staple in every wardrobe, effortlessly adapting to the vibrancy of summer, the warmth of autumn, the chill of winter, and the freshness of spring. Whether you are dressing for a casual daytime outing or a sophisticated evening event, understanding which shades complement blue can elevate your style to new heights.

For warmer months, consider pairing bright shades of blue with softer pastels like lavender, mint green, or blush pink. These combinations create a refreshing and light-hearted look, making it ideal for outdoor gatherings or beach days. In summer, accessorizing with white or beige can enhance the vibrancy of your blue pieces, while still keeping your outfit polished. For example, a bright blue sundress paired with white sandals and a straw hat is both chic and seasonally appropriate.

As the leaves turn and the air cools, deep blues work beautifully with autumnal hues such as burgundy, rust, and mustard. These rich colors not only contrast with blue but also add warmth, keeping your wardrobe in tune with the season. Opt for a navy turtleneck paired with rust-colored culottes and a mustard scarf for a stylish fall ensemble that pops. Accessories in warm earth tones or gold can tie the look together beautifully.

Come winter, deeper shades of blue, like navy and midnight blue, can be contrasted with jewel tones like emerald green, rich plum, or even gold. This combination radiates sophistication and elegance, perfect for holiday parties and winter celebrations. For instance, a navy dress paired with emerald earrings and a plum handbag can create a striking yet cohesive look. Finally, in spring, lighter blues reconnect with nature by complementing shades of yellow or coral, embodying the essence of regeneration and renewal. A light blue shirt paired with coral trousers offers a fresh vibe that embraces the changing season.

Top Color Combinations: Blue with Neutrals

Top Color Combinations: Blue with Neutrals
Soft, muted neutrals serve as the perfect backdrop to highlight the vibrancy of blue, creating a visually striking yet harmonious ensemble. Neutrals such as beige, gray, and soft white not only complement various shades of blue but also ensure that your outfit maintains an elegant and polished aesthetic. For instance, pairing a crisp white blouse with a deep navy skirt offers a timeless look that radiates sophistication. This classic combination is not only versatile for work settings but also effortlessly transitions into evening wear with the right accessories.

When looking to infuse a bit of trendiness into your neutral-blue combinations, consider incorporating textured elements. A light blue chambray shirt juxtaposed against a pair of muted white linen trousers can add depth to your outfit. Accentuating this look with a pair of taupe or beige sandals and a matching belt helps to keep the overall appearance cohesive. Moreover, accessorizing with earthy metallics, like gold or bronze jewelry, can bring warmth and a touch of luxury, amplifying the neutral tones while maintaining the anchor of blue.

Accessorizing Tips

To achieve a seamless blend of blue and neutrals in your wardrobe, keep these accessory tips in mind:

  • Footwear: Opt for neutral footwear, such as nude heels or beige flats, to elongate your legs and maintain focus on your blue pieces.
  • Bags: A taupe crossbody or a cream tote can elegantly tie your outfit together while adding practicality.
  • Jewelry: Choose simple, delicate jewelry in gold or silver tones that won’t compete with the boldness of blue.

Bold Pairings: Vibrant Colors to Match Blue

Bold Pairings: Vibrant Colors to Match Blue
From bold and spirited oranges to vibrant yellows and daring pinks, the world of color offers an incredible playground for pairing with blue. These colorful combinations not only add a refreshing dimension to your outfits but also enhance the overall aesthetic of your wardrobe. A striking contrast can energize your look and highlight blue’s inherent vibrancy, allowing for self-expression through thoughtful color choices.

For instance, cobalt blue pairs beautifully with a rich coral or tangerine. Imagine a cobalt dress accentuated with coral accessories-a statement necklace or a pair of striking heels can create an unforgettable ensemble perfect for summer outings or tropical vacations. Similarly, a bold royal blue shirt tucked into mustard yellow pants can present a lively outfit choice for a casual brunch or a laid-back office day. This combination brings warmth and character, asserting confidence while remaining undeniably stylish.

Another era of color pairing that reigns supreme is blue with jewel tones like emerald green and deep purple. Picture an emerald green maxi skirt harmonizing with a fitted navy top; this combination should strike the right balance between elegance and boldness, making it suitable for evening events or formal occasions. You can enhance these hues with gold or silver accessories, letting the colors do the talking while adding a touch of sophistication.

Accessorizing for Impact

When you’re blending vibrant colors with blue, consider the accessories that can tie your look together. Choose accessories in complementary shades or metallics to highlight the boldness of your outfit:

  • Footwear: Opt for shoes that echo one of the vibrant colors. For example, vibrant red or orange pumps can elevate a blue outfit, infusing the look with a playful energy.
  • Bags: Select bags in contrasting colors or similar bold hues to keep the focus dynamic. A bright yellow handbag can be the perfect touch against a blue ensemble.
  • Jewelry: Don’t shy away from statement pieces that incorporate complementary colors or materials. A chunky gem necklace featuring a mix of blue and green tones can beautifully enhance the overall look.

Shoe Styles That Pair Perfectly with Blue

When it comes to footwear, the right pair can truly elevate a blue ensemble, creating an attractive balance between style and comfort. Think of your shoes as the finishing touch that can either integrate smoothly with your outfit or stand out as a stunning contrast. Here are some key styles that can beautifully complement various shades of blue, whether it’s a light sky blue, a deep navy, or a vibrant cobalt.

  • Nude and Beige Shoes: Timeless and versatile, nude and beige footwear creates a clean, elongated silhouette that pairs flawlessly with any shade of blue. Consider strappy sandals or classic pumps for a sophisticated touch that lets your blue outfit shine.
  • Metallics: For a touch of glamour, opt for metallic shoes in silver or gold. These reflective shades add a luxe appeal and can draw attention without overpowering your blue look. Silver heels, in particular, work wonderfully with cooler blue tones.
  • Bold Colors: If you’re looking to make a statement, don’t shy away from vibrant hues. Bright yellow, fiery red, or emerald green shoes can create a striking contrast with blue, injecting energy and excitement into your outfit. Think bright red ankle boots or a pair of vivid yellow stilettos that can transform a simple blue dress into a head-turning look.
  • Printed or Textured Footwear: Integrating patterns or textures into your shoe choice-like leopard print flats or suede ankle boots-can add a playful element to your blues. This approach can soften the overall appearance while introducing visual intrigue that stands out.

When considering seasonal styling, adapt your shoe choices accordingly. Think sleek mules or open-toed sandals in summer, while ankle boots paired with tights can keep you cozy in cooler months. Embracing Patterns: Stylish Prints to Combine with Blue

In the world of fashion, patterns offer a dynamic means to express personal style, especially when paired with the versatile hue of blue. This calming color acts as a perfect canvas for a variety of prints that energize and elevate any outfit. Whether you’re stepping out for a casual lunch or dressing up for a special occasion, thoughtfully combining blue with stylish patterns can result in a polished and contemporary look.

One popular approach is to incorporate floral patterns, which beautifully complement blue’s soothing qualities. A floral dress featuring navy and white blossoms creates an effortlessly chic ensemble, while a blue top with delicate floral accents can liven up a pair of solid white trousers. Aim for prints that feature shades of blue in their designs to maintain color harmony. Accessorizing with similar shades in your jewelry or shoes can elevate the entire look; think of choosing pastel blue sandals or a subtle silver bracelet.

Stripes are another fantastic option that can add visual complexity without overwhelming the palette. A classic blue and white striped shirt paired with tailored chinos creates a timeless outfit suitable for various occasions. For a more casual vibe, wearing a denim jacket with vertical stripes gives a nod to current trends while ensuring a cohesive appearance. Combine these pieces with neutral trousers or shorts to keep the focus on the stripes.

For those feeling bold, abstract and geometric patterns offer an invigorating flair. A geometric print in shades of blue, gray, and white not only commands attention but also adds an element of modern sophistication. These prints can be worn as statement pieces; for instance, a maxi skirt featuring swirling blue shapes can be paired with a simple solid top to balance the look. Complete this outfit with minimalistic accessories, opting for solid-color shoes that allow the patterns to truly shine.

Utilizing patterns allows you to play with textures and layers, creating depth in your outfit. A patterned scarf in blue tones can add warmth and interest when styled with a solid-colored coat during the cooler months. Furthermore, don’t shy away from mixing patterns; a floral dress paired with a striped cardigan can create an effortlessly chic layered look that showcases your unique fashion sensibility. Faq

Q: What colors look good with navy blue?
A: Navy blue pairs well with colors like crisp white, soft pastels, and vibrant yellows. For a sophisticated look, try pairing it with burgundy or forest green. Incorporating these colors can enhance your navy attire and provide a refreshing contrast.

Q: Can I wear black with blue?
A: Yes, black can be a stylish complement to blue. A black top with blue jeans creates a classic look, while a blue blazer over a black dress can add elegance. Experiment with shades like midnight blue for a refined pairing.

Q: What color accessories go with blue outfits?
A: Opt for metallics like gold and silver, which harmonize beautifully with blue outfits. Additionally, orange or coral accessories can add a playful contrast. Choose pieces that enhance your overall look without overwhelming it.

Q: How can I style blue in a professional outfit?
A: For a professional look, pair blue blazers with white or light gray blouses and trousers. Accessories in neutral tones and simple patterns, like stripes, can add professionalism while maintaining a stylish edge.

Q: What are trendy colors that go with blue this season?
A: This season, trend-forward shades like mustard yellow, burnt orange, and soft blush are ideal companions for blue. Incorporating these colors into your outfits can create a chic, modern look that is perfect for any occasion.

Q: How do I mix patterns with blue clothing?
A: When mixing patterns with blue clothing, choose one pattern to dominate, like stripes or florals. Use blue as a unifying color, ensuring that other patterns incorporate blue shades to create visual harmony.

Q: What shoes should I wear with blue?
A: Blue outfits pair well with neutral options like nude or black shoes. For a bolder choice, try red or metallic shoes to create a striking effect. Ensure your shoe choice complements the overall tone of your outfit.

Q: Are there specific shades of blue that work for different skin tones?
A: Yes, warmer skin tones typically complement warmer blues like teal, while cooler skin tones often look better in cooler shades like navy or icy blue. Understanding your undertone can help you select the most flattering shades of blue for your wardrobe.
